The last Apollo mission was Apollo 17, which launched on December 7, 1972 and successfully landed on the Moon. It was the sixth mission to land astronauts on the Moon and the final mission of the Apollo program.

Apollo 11 was the first manned mission to ever land on the moon. Apollo 8 was the first manned mission to actually travel to the moon, but they did not land.
No, Apollo 8 was the first manned mission the orbit the moon but it did not land on it.
The last man to stand on the moon was Gene Cernan, Commander of Apollo 17.
